Southwest Cream Cheese Chicken Wraps Recipe

Chicken and cream cheese are combined with red peppers, black beans, corn,  shredded cheddar and southwest spices, then wrapped in flour tortillas for a hearty lunch or light dinner.




yield: 6-8 SERVINGS

INGREDIENTS

1 tablespoon olive oil
3 cups cooked, shredded chicken
1/2 teaspoon cumin ground
1 1/2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
Dash of cayenne pepper
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 jalapeno, seeded and finely chopped
1 red bell pepper, diced
1 cup frozen corn, thawed
1 (15 oz.) can black beans, drained and rinsed
1 cup sour cream
4 ounces cream cheese, softened and cubed
1 tablespoon lime juice
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1/4 cup chopped green onions
1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
6-8 large wraps or tortillas
1 1/2 to 2 cups tortilla strips, optional



INSTRUCTIONS

  1.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the shredded chicken, cumin, chili powder, onion powder, garlic, and peppers. Cook about 5 minutes, or until mixture is warmed through and peppers are just tender.
  2. Stir in the corn, beans, sour cream, cream cheese and lime juice. Continue cooking and stirring until cream cheese is melted. Remove from heat and stir in the cheddar cheese, green onions and cilantro.
  3. Divide the mixture between the wraps and sprinkle with tortilla strips, if desired. Roll up tightly and serve immediately.
